About Yoga Instructor
A Yoga Instructor teaches yoga postures (asanas), breathing (pranayama), and often relaxation or meditation practices. A good instructor doesn’t just “lead a class”—they observe alignment, offer modifications, and help you progress safely based on mobility, injuries, and fitness level.
You typically need a Yoga Instructor when you:
- Are new to yoga and want to learn proper form
- Have tight hips/hamstrings, back discomfort, or posture issues and want safer movement
- Need stress reduction and structured breathing/relaxation
- Want a home-visit routine or a private plan that fits your schedule
- Are returning after injury, pregnancy, or a long fitness break (with appropriate medical clearance when needed)

Licensing or certifications: Pakistan does not commonly publish a government licensing requirement specifically for yoga teaching. However, many instructors build credibility through recognized training pathways (for example, 200-hour/500-hour teacher training programs, Yoga Alliance-style credentials, physiotherapy or fitness backgrounds). Always ask what training and continuing education they have completed.

What’s the difference between yoga for fitness and yoga for therapy?
Fitness-oriented yoga may be faster-paced and strength-focused. Therapeutic yoga is typically slower, modification-heavy, and may overlap with rehabilitation principles. If you have a medical condition, ask how the instructor adapts the practice and consider medical guidance.
Can I do yoga if I have back pain?
Often yes, but it depends on the cause and severity. Choose an instructor experienced with modifications, avoid forcing deep stretches, and seek medical advice if pain is sharp, radiating, or persistent.
